Ernest Espinoza is the new Regional Director of The Children's Bereavement Center of the Rio Grande Valley and is joining us today to keep us updated on the impact their organization has on not only counciling grieving children but their families as well. They offer free services to those in need and their non-profit is entirely funded by the generosity of their donors.

Ernest Espinoza was born in Chicago, Illinois and has one sister. But his parents quickly moved to Houston, Texas where his father, Ernesto Espinoza took a job with NASA as a space engineer. Ernest enjoyed working out, playing sports and was on many swim teams as a youth. He was a top swimmer in High School. Ernest graduated in 1995 with a degree in Business Management from the University of Houston. 
In 1997 Ernest started working for the non-profit Sam Houston Area Council, Boy Scouts of America in Houston, Texas. Since then, he worked for 24 years in various Boy Scout Councils across the nation from Houston, Dallas, Chicago, California and Harlingen, Texas. Ernest has also volunteered in Quito, Ecuador in the Scouts of Ecuador. He has enjoyed working on all operations of the company from fundraising, strategic planning, cultivating donors, managing employees and thousands of volunteers, accounting, budgeting and much more.
Ernest is recently married to Eben in June of 2021 and has three wonderful children, Matthew, Michael and Nathania. He enjoys spending time with his family.
Ernest is excited to lead The Children’s Bereavement Center RGC!
